在使用dedecms程序构建的网站中,用户可能会遇到上传图片后出现图片错乱的问题。这种问题通常表现为上传的图片顺序、位置或显示不正常,影响了网站的视觉效果和用户体验。本文将详细介绍如何解决这一问题。
问题分析
图片错乱的问题可能由多种原因导致,包括程序bug、服务器设置、浏览器兼容性等。为了准确找出问题原因,我们需要逐一排查。
1. 检查程序版本:确保您的dedecms程序是最新版本,如果不是,请升级到最新版本以修复可能的bug。
2. 检查服务器设置:确保服务器设置正确,没有对上传的图片进行错误的处理或修改。
3. 检查浏览器兼容性:不同浏览器的图片渲染方式可能存在差异,尝试在不同浏览器中查看图片是否正常。
4. 检查上传代码:检查网站上传图片的代码,看是否有逻辑错误或语法错误导致图片错乱。
解决方法
1. 清理缓存:清理网站缓存和浏览器缓存,有时候缓存中的错误数据会导致图片错乱。
2. 重新上传:尝试重新上传图片,确保上传过程中没有出现错误。
3. 调整图片命名规则:确保图片文件名遵循一定的规则,避免出现重复或特殊字符导致的错乱。
4. 修改程序代码:如果问题出在程序代码上,需要修改相应的代码,确保图片处理的逻辑正确。
5. 使用第三方工具:可以使用一些第三方工具对上传的图片进行预处理,以确保图片的格式、大小和命名等都符合网站的要求。
6. 联系技术支持:如果以上方法都无法解决问题,建议联系dedecms的技术支持团队寻求帮助。
预防措施
1. 定期备份:定期备份网站数据和程序文件,以便在出现问题时可以快速恢复。
2. 监控系统:建立网站监控系统,实时监测网站的运行状态和图片上传情况,以便及时发现并解决问题。
3. 用户教育:对用户进行教育,告知他们正确的上传方式和注意事项,以减少因用户操作不当导致的问题。
4. 更新与维护:定期更新dedecms程序和插件,以确保网站的安全性和稳定性。定期对网站进行维护和优化,以提高网站的运行效率。